Output ef34a3d559e457b791108a1190c9bafc7e1603b1aa6a29cb34a776c3bf473c88:1

value
7496839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c6a817fd9b7cb856a16ed850e50f6ee53f38b92 OP_EQUALVERIFY OP_CHECKSIG
address
1KdrSHps2ESctarMA4fQ4boyxuG8q7g9VF
transaction
ef34a3d559e457b791108a1190c9bafc7e1603b1aa6a29cb34a776c3bf473c88
confirmations
421507
spent
true